/*
* Regression coverage for an alignment edge case in the Linux STFLE path.
*
* When ZDNN_ENABLE_PRECHECK is enabled, invoke_stfle() verifies the facility
* list buffer is 8-byte aligned. Historically, zdnn_is_nnpa_installed() used a
* local unsigned-char array which is not *guaranteed* to be 8-byte aligned.
*
* This test asserts that enabling precheck does not trigger a
* ZDNN_MISALIGNED_PARMBLOCK failure in the STFLE path.
*
* Note: This is a Linux-only behavior; z/OS uses a system copy of STFLE.
*/

void setUp(void) {
#ifdef __MVS__
TEST_IGNORE_MESSAGE("Linux STFLE alignment regression test; skipping on z/OS");
#endif
}

void tearDown(void) {}

void test_precheck_does_not_trigger_misaligned_parmblock(void) {
precheck_enabled = true;

char buf_stderr[BUFSIZ] = {0};

stderr_to_pipe();
(void)zdnn_is_nnpa_installed();
restore_stderr(buf_stderr, BUFSIZ);

TEST_ASSERT_NULL_MESSAGE(
strstr(buf_stderr, "ZDNN_MISALIGNED_PARMBLOCK"),
"Unexpected misaligned parmblock failure in STFLE path");

precheck_enabled = false;
}

int main(void) {
UNITY_BEGIN();

RUN_TEST(test_precheck_does_not_trigger_misaligned_parmblock);

return UNITY_END();
}

bool zdnn_is_nnpa_installed() {
#ifndef __MVS__
int nnpa_supported;
unsigned char facilities[STFLE_LENGTH] = {0};
// invoke_stfle() requires the facility list to be 8-byte aligned when
// ZDNN_ENABLE_PRECHECK is enabled. Using a uint64_t array guarantees the
// required alignment regardless of compiler/stack placement decisions.
uint64_t facilities64[STFLE_LENGTH / 8] = {0};
int cc;
cc = invoke_stfle(facilities);
cc = invoke_stfle((unsigned char *)facilities64);

if (cc) {
LOG_ERROR("STFLE failed with %d", cc);
return false;
}

nnpa_supported = check_bitfield(facilities, STFLE_NNPA);
nnpa_supported = check_bitfield((uint8_t *)facilities64, STFLE_NNPA);

LOG_INFO("Hardware NNPA support available - %s",
nnpa_supported ? "TRUE" : "FALSE");
